#22826e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#22826e is composed of 13.3% red, 51% green and 43.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 15.4%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 167.5 degrees, a saturation of 58.5% and a lightness of 32.2%. #22826e color hex could be obtained by blending #44ffdc with #000500.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#22826e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#22826e has RGB values of R:34, G:130, B:110 and CMYK values of C:0.74, M:0, Y:0.15,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 2261614.

Shades and Tints of #22826e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010605 is the darkest color, while #f5fcf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#22826e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4e5654 is the less saturated color, while #02a280 is the most saturated one.
